Five-star townhomes have skyline views (Austin American-Statesman)

What: These two new townhomes, in the Travis Heights neighborhood south of downtown Austin, have received a five-star rating from the Austin Energy Green Building Program. The program rates homes for energy-efficiency, temperature and moisture control, sustainable materials and other features. Five stars is the highest rating.
